Walk In Shower Installation in Sarasota, FL
Walk-in shower installation services provide homeowners with a convenient and accessible upgrade to their bathrooms. This type of project typically involves replacing existing shower setups with modern, open-entry designs that do not require a door or curtain. Property owners may choose walk-in showers for their sleek appearance, ease of use, and to maximize space in smaller bathrooms. Before requesting installation, it’s helpful to consider the current bathroom layout, preferred shower style, and any specific features such as seating, grab bars, or custom tiling that might enhance usability and aesthetics.
Homeowners often want to understand the scope of work involved, including the removal of existing fixtures, waterproofing, and the installation of new shower enclosures. It’s also common to inquire about available materials, finishes, and options for customizing the shower to match the overall bathroom design.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project aligns with personal preferences and functional needs, making the transition to a walk-in shower smooth and satisfying.

Walk In Shower Installation Questions
What are the common types of walk-in showers available? Walk-in showers can be customized with various designs, including frameless glass enclosures, tiled stalls, and low-threshold options to suit different bathroom styles and accessibility needs.
Can walk-in showers be added to existing bathrooms? Yes, walk-in showers are often installed in existing bathrooms, with options to modify or replace current setups for improved accessibility and modern appeal.
What materials are typically used for walk-in shower installations? Popular materials include ceramic, porcelain, glass, and natural stone, chosen for durability, ease of cleaning, and aesthetic appeal.
Are there design considerations for small bathroom spaces? Compact walk-in showers can be designed with clear glass, corner installations, and built-in storage to maximize space and functionality in smaller bathrooms.
